11 Changes to SCCS Guides for Cosmetics Safety Testing — Plus a Note on 'Nano'

The European Union's (EU's) Scientific Committee on Consumer Safety (SCCS) recently updated its notes of guidance (NoG) for cosmetics and cosmetic ingredient safety testing, emphasizing alternatives to animal testing, nanomaterials and more.

John Paul Mitchell Hit with Suit Alleging False 'No Animal Testing' Claim

John Paul Mitchell Systems is facing a class action suit alleging its "no animal testing" promise was broken to meet regulatory requirements in China to gain access to the market.

Virginia Becomes Fourth US State to Ban Cosmetic Animal Testing
Virginia is now the fourth US state to ban cosmetic animal testing after Governor Ralph Northam recently signed the Virginia Humane Cosmetics Act [VHCA] into law. The legislation was drafted by state Senator Jennifer Boysko and Delegate Kaye Kory, authoring the policy that aims to ban the testing of new cosmetics and the sale of animal-tested cosmetics by January 1st of next year. Virginia joins California, Nevada, and Illinois in banning animal cruelty in cosmetic production.
“This fantastic news illustrates a growing momentum in efforts to end unnecessary testing on animals in the United States and around the world for products like shampoos, mascara, and lipstick,” president of the Humane Society Legislative Fund Sara Amundson said. “Consumers are scanning labels and demanding products free of animal testing, cosmetics companies are listening to them and changing their practices and lawmakers are solidifying these changes into a permanent policy.”
